Best Practice for In Force Cases: Annual Reviews

By keeping your in force GSI cases up to date, you can keep your clients happy and boost your commissions. You can earn first-year commissions on both in force benefit increases and new additions each year. Conducting annual reviews of your in force GSI cases is good for you and good for your clients.

The first step? Get an updated census from your current clients. We’ll review your cases each year to:

  • Offer increases in coverage to meet earnings growth. Are employees making more? If so, we’ll increase coverage to match their higher incomes — up to the plan limit. 
  • Capture any missed additions. New hires and existing employees who newly meet the member definition should be added to the case throughout the year. The annual case review provides a double check that all eligible employees are participating in the plan.
  • Determine if it’s time for a plan-design change. Are employees reaching the maximum benefit limit before meeting the target income replacement? If so, The Standard can review the plan to see if it’s time to offer a plan-wide increase.
